About B6 7DY

B6 7DY scores 46/100 on the NestScope Score, with its strongest showing in local amenities and healthcare — with Tesco Aston Lane Superstore about 10 minutes' walk away. The main trade-off is its schools score. The breakdown below draws on official UK data covering schools, safety, healthcare, transport, environment and local amenities.

In national context, B6 7DY is a more affordable, lower-income neighbourhood — IMD decile 1/10, ranked 530 of 32,844 neighbourhoods in England. The Index of Multiple Deprivation is the UK government's official measure of relative deprivation, refreshed roughly every five years. Housing pressure here is high (IMD housing decile 1/10).

There are 90 schools within the typical catchment area, including 8 rated Outstanding by Ofsted and 51 rated Good. The nearest school is Deykin Avenue Junior and Infant School (Ofsted: Inadequate), about 2 minutes' walk away.

There were 14 crimes reported on the surrounding streets in the most recent month, indicating a low level of immediate-area crime.

Healthcare access is good, with 27 GP surgeries, 1 hospital and 9 dental practices in the wider neighbourhood. The nearest GP practice is AL-SHAFA MEDICAL CENTRE, about 10 minutes' walk away. The nearest hospital is NORTHCROFT HOSPITAL, 1.1 mi away. A pharmacy is about 10 minutes' walk away.
